Hydroxyanthracene derivatives in food and food supplements
Hydroxyanthracene derivatives are a class of naturally occurring chemicals found in various botanical species and used in food or food supplements to improve intestinal function by exploiting their laxative effect. Plants containing hydroxyanthracene derivatives are numerous and belong to different botanical families and genera. For instance they are naturally found in some species of aloe and senna.
According to EFSA (European Food Safety Authority) and other European and international bodies, including the World Health Organisation, the European Medicines Agency, and the German Federal Institute for Risk Assessment, some derivatives of hydroxyanthracene are genotoxic; there is therefore a risk that a constant use will damage the DNA. In addition, animal studies have led to the conclusion that some derivatives of hydroxyanthracene could favor the appearance of cancer in the intestine. No daily safety limit has been established for the use of these substances.
Therefore in March 2021 the European Commission published the Commission Regulation (EU) 2021/468 of 18 March 2021 amending Annex III to Regulation (EC) No 1925/2006 of the European Parliament and of the Council as regards botanical species containing hydroxyanthracene derivatives. Annex III, part A, to Regulation (EC) No 1925/2006 is amended as follows (Annex III, part A, to Regulation (EC) No 1925/2006.):
Preparations from the leaf of Aloe species containing hydroxyanthracene derivatives |
Aloe-emodin and all preparations in which this substance is present |
Emodin and all preparations in which this substance is present |
Danthron and all preparations in which this substance is present |
